What companies run services between Porto, Portugal and Bayonne, France?

B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Porto - Terminal Intermodal de Campanhã to Bayonne - Quai de Lesseps Bus Stop 5 times a day. Tickets cost €75–140 and the journey takes 11h 59m. Two other operators also service this route. Alternatively, you can take a train from Porto Campanha to Bayonne via Redondela De Galicia, Pontevedra, Madrid Chamartín, Irun, Irun, Hendaia, and Hendaye in around 16h 20m.
